Internet Companies Sturring a Speed War?

Features | April 29th, 2009 by Staggs

Oh yes, the Spidey-senses are tingling on this one. Today Cablevision, a major television and broadband provider, announced that they would offer intense download speeds of 101Mbps and upload speeds at 15Mbps, the most speed to come out of any major ISP.
